My venerable DCP8065DN has been so dependable that it took me literal days to remember, yes, it has consumable parts and that might be why the prints look weird.
I now vaguely recall replacing the toner 12 years ago.
The onboard diagnostic estimates that the drum has 64% left.
This printer might outlive me.
Never change, Brother.
